Some classes do better with less tenacity and others need more tenacity (although tenacity is a MUST for PVP only the amount needed differs between classes). The problem is that stacking tenacity and the gear that gives tenacity makes it difficult to stack your power/crit/armor pen high enough without using only the small amount of gear pieces that give you the stats you need. In PVP the GWF needs at least 800 tenacity if he/she wants to survive long enough to make a difference and likely it needs more than 800 tenacity if he/she wants to really be able to turn the match in their team’s favour. The first nerf to Unstoppable broke the tank abilities of the GWF because they could survive longer with the defence bonus it gave and with less tenacity. Now stacking tenacity makes it difficult to stack enough of the other needed stats of the offense type. This caused the players who want to do serious PVP to resort to pay to win because the only way you can get enough of all the needed stats is with the artefact gear on Legendary (5-9 mil AD per piece depending on Auction house prices for refinement stones) and also only certain types of gear will give the right stats which basically takes away any kind of creativity for builds anyone can have.
